What I like about Ferry is that while some of his songs are leaning toward being more poppy he still remixes some of his own tracks with a more trancey twist with his "Flashover" productions. I think it's a cool way for him to broaden his appeal to the masses and yet still satisfy the Trance Addicts. And beyond his own Flashover Remixes, there's always outside productions too. I really like the original and Flashover mixes of It's time, but I also love the thumping basslines in the Kai Tracid and Luke Slater mixes as well. The Agnelli & Nelson Remix is the only one which is bleh for me.
